It was a successful event with over 50 delegates hearing the latest research on RF materials and antenna manufacturing techniques. During the course of the two days; we heard lots of interesting and varied talks from a variety of speakers from industry and academia, including University of Birmingham, University of Exeter and BAE Systems.
There was lots of networking over some lovely lunches from Austin Court and some post conference networking over dinner and drinks for some of the delegates.
The seminar ended with a panel session featuring some of the speakers: Professor Yiannis Vardaxoglou, Professor Woon-Hong Yeo, Murray Niman. The session was chaired by committee member Costas Constantinou and during the session a variety of topics were covered including what applications are anticipated in 5 and in 10 years’ time and what barriers exist to development & exploitation in relevant environments.
